Sodium C14-16 Olefin Sulfonate

Sodium C14-16 Olefin Sulfonate (CAS# 68439-57-6) is the sodium salt of sulfonic acids derived from C14-16 alkane hydroxy and C14-16 alkene. It is a versatile and biodegradable cleansing agent known for its high cleaning power and strong foaming properties. Despite its biodegradability, its potent cleansing and foaming characteristics are associated with harshness on the skin.

● Benefits

Provides effective cleansing and rich foam formation, making it a high-performance surfactant in rinse-off formulations. Its biodegradability is noted as an environmental advantage.

● Cautions

Considered harsh on the skin due to its high cleaning power and strong foaming properties; may cause irritation, particularly with frequent or prolonged use.
